## Timeline — 14:22

The Quenbar billing worker blue-green cutover began. Green pool (new build) took 10% of invoice jobs while blue retained the rest. At 14:26 we observed duplicate charge attempts: the job-claim lease was not honored across pools because green read a stale lease table snapshot. Cutover was paused at 14:29 and traffic pinned to blue. For the reviewer, the exact green build is recorded below.

build token for kagaf-hahof: htk14_9d3d4d26d7d8de

### Key Ceremony Checklist — Item 7: SQL Lint Rules (Project Saltgrove)

Yep, even the linter config gets ceremonially signed now — blame the Great Migration Mishap of last spring. Before signing, confirm the Saltgrove SQL ruleset still bans `SELECT *` in views, requires explicit `ORDER BY` in paginated queries, and flags untagged migrations. If all three checks pass and both witnesses agree, you're clear to open the signing keybox using the passphrase directly below.

strongbox words: prawyn-fenmir

## Image Slimming: Pushing to the Lintbarrel Registry

When slimming container images for the Quornet platform, always start from the approved distroless base and strip build toolchains in the final stage. Verify the resulting image with `quorctl inspect --layers` and confirm the size is under 120 MB before tagging. New team members: never push directly to production channels; use the staging lane until your first three pushes are reviewed by the Fennwick team. To authenticate the push against the Lintbarrel registry gateway, use the key below.

gateway credential: kto23_LX9A4ys6i4nzHtpOLNLodKK